Nim’s Island – Movie Review

If “Nim’s Island” were anything but a children’s movie, the casting genius who suggested Jodie Foster as a potential love interest for Gerard Butler would be looking for a new occupation. But miscasting isn’t the only problem with this sweet but ho-hum adaptation of Wendy Orr’s novel, a comedy-adventure that never quite finds its tone.

My Blueberry Nights – Movie Review

Anyone who has been to Las Vegas, Memphis or New York — or who has received postcards from friends in those cities — is likely to find “My Blueberry Nights,” Wong Kar-wai’s first English-language feature, wildly unrealistic, even though much of it was shot on location in the real-deal U.S.A. Leatherheads Movie Review (2008)

Actor/director/producer/humanitarian/Oscar-winner/all-around Hollywood good-guy George Clooney brings the bygone days of screwball comedies back to life on the big screen with Leatherheads, co-starring Renee Zellweger and Jim from The Office (aka John Krasinski). Shaurya Movie Review (2008)

A story of humanity and attitudinal differences causing social destruction, Shaurya scores well in the execution department.
